Cedar shingle replacement services involve removing aging or damaged sh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of’s appearance and functionality. This process typically starts with a thorough inspection to identify shingles that are cracked, curled, or missing. Once the affected shingles are carefully taken out, new cedar shingles are precisely fitted and secured to match the existing roof design. The goal is to improve the roof’s durability, prevent water leaks, and enhance the overall curb appeal of the property.
These services are particularly helpful for addressing common problems such as weather-related wear, rot, mold, or insect damage that can compromise the integrity of cedar shingles over time. When shingles start to deteriorate, they can allow moisture to penetrate the roof structure, leading to more extensive repairs if left unaddressed. Replacement helps to eliminate these vulnerabilities, protecting the home from potential water damage and prolonging the lifespan of the roof.

The overview below groups typical Cedar Shingles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ottawa,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cedar shingle repairs usually fall between $250 and $600, covering tasks like replacing a few damaged shingles or sealing leaks. Most routine jobs land within this range, depending on the extent of damage and material costs.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of cedar shingles often costs between $1,000 and $3,000, depending on the size of the area and complexity of access. Many projects in this category stay within this range, with larger or more intricate jobs reaching higher costs.
Full Replacement - Complete cedar shingle roof replacements typically range from $8,000 to $15,000, depending on roof size and shingle quality. While most full replacements fall into this band, larger or custom projects can exceed $20,000 in some cases.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Larger, more complex cedar shingle replacements or historic restoration projects can cost $20,000 and above. These jobs are less common but are handled by local contractors with experience in high-end or detailed work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are cedar shingle replacement services? Cedar sh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or aging cedar sh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of's appearance and function.
Why should I consider replacing cedar shingles instead of repairing them? Replacement is often recommended when shingles are severely deteriorated or widespread damage occurs, ensuring the roof remains durable and visually appealing.
How do local contractors handle cedar shingle replacement projects? Local contractors assess the condition of existing shingles, carefully remove damaged ones, and install new cedar shingles that match the existing roof for a seamless look.
What types of cedar shingles are available for replacement? There are various cedar shingle styles, including traditional, tapersawn, and resawn options, which contractors can help select based on the roof’s design and your preferences.
